Output fd15e9a2072026bdee6bcc741978ef0d1c11125831552aa8417f58547a5b3efc:23

value
667400
script pubkey
OP_0 OP_PUSHBYTES_20 ddb8cdf32ab1056852990fb3744353c63bb2841b
address
bc1qmkuvmue2kyzks55ep7ehgs6nccam9pqm82qxj3
transaction
fd15e9a2072026bdee6bcc741978ef0d1c11125831552aa8417f58547a5b3efc
spent
true